Arizona Pocket Mouse vs Clamorous Reed Warbler

Perognathus amplus compared with Acrocephalus stentoreus

Taxonomic Classification

Rank Arizona Pocket Mouse Clamorous Reed Warbler
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Aves (Birds)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Passeriformes (Songbirds)
Family Heteromyidae Acrocephalidae
Genus Perognathus Acrocephalus
Species Perognathus amplus Acrocephalus stentoreus

Evolutionary Relationship

Arizona Pocket Mouse and Clamorous Reed Warbler share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
